Output 7a89e2925c74385f39f30e6562c29deabeb007f3f025abb58e93c9d34e6d2e91:2
- value
- 50038665
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42f75858395e05df1ce8b71c0d5c0ac104cbef66 OP_EQUAL
- address
- 37o6q3TMRAqpps6upzxEpctJEZNKqCcfMG
- transaction
- 7a89e2925c74385f39f30e6562c29deabeb007f3f025abb58e93c9d34e6d2e91
- confirmations
- 356481
- spent
- true